By choosing an art print of McCubbin, you invite the very essence of Australian art into your home, enriching your living space with vibrant and moving scenes.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ch2\u003eBiographical FAQ on Frederick McCubbin\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eWho was Frederick McCubbin?\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Frederick McCubbin was an Australian painter born in 1855 in Melbourne. He became one of the leading figures of the Heidelberg School, a group of artists who played a crucial role in the development of impressionism in Australia. McCubbin began his career as an apprentice in his father's bakery before turning to art, where he found his true calling. His works are known for their depiction of everyday life and Australian landscapes.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eWhat artistic style characterizes McCubbin?\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Frederick McCubbin is primarily associated with impressionism, but his style evolved over the years to include elements of realism. His paintings stand out for their masterful use of light and color, capturing the essence of the Australian landscape with poetic sensitivity. McCubbin often used broad brushstrokes and balanced compositions to create works that are both powerful and moving.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eWhat were McCubbin’s major influences?\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eMcCubbin was influenced by European impressionist masters such as Claude Monet and Camille Pissarro. McCubbin left behind a rich collection of paintings that testify to his talent and unique artistic vision.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eAre there any interesting anecdotes about McCubbin?\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An interesting anecdote about McCubbin is that he often used his own family as models for his paintings. For example, his wife and children appear in several of his works, adding a personal and intimate dimension to his paintings. This practice allowed him to capture authentic expressions and moments, thereby strengthening the emotional impact of his works.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ch2\u003eFrederick McCubbin’s Artistic Journey\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eTraining and Beginnings\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Frederick McCubbin began his artistic training at the National Gallery of Victoria Art School, where he studied under renowned artists such as Eugene von Guerard. This training allowed him to develop his technical skills and explore different artistic approaches. From the start, McCubbin showed exceptional talent in painting, which quickly set him apart from his peers.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eKey Period\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eMcCubbin’s key period was in the 1880s and 1890s, when he joined the Heidelberg School. It was during this time that he produced some of his most famous works, exploring landscapes and scenes of everyday life in Australia.
